
Kris C. worked on enhancing Salesforce packaging workflows across the forcedotcom/packaging and salesforcecli/plugin-packaging repositories, focusing on reliability, error clarity, and developer experience. He migrated package version retrieval to the Package2Version API, refactored error handling, and improved metadata messaging to address edge cases where packaging features were unavailable. Using TypeScript and Node.js, Kris introduced new user permissions management, updated automated tests for duplicate assignments, and improved documentation to align with evolving APIs. His work emphasized stability and compatibility, including targeted rollbacks and UX improvements, resulting in more robust backend and CLI development for Salesforce packaging operations.

July 2025 monthly summary for salesforcecli/plugin-packaging. Focused on delivering packaging enhancements by migrating package version retrieval to Package2Version API, updating UX and docs, and improving discoverability. No critical bugs fixed this month; changes emphasize stability, compatibility, and developer experience.
July 2025 monthly summary for salesforcecli/plugin-packaging. Focused on delivering packaging enhancements by migrating package version retrieval to Package2Version API, updating UX and docs, and improving discoverability. No critical bugs fixed this month; changes emphasize stability, compatibility, and developer experience.
June 2025 monthly summary for forcedotcom/packaging. Focus on delivering reliable packaging capabilities and enabling packaging operations in the Dev Hub. The month delivered key features and fixes that improve reliability, error clarity, and security- and test-robustness across packaging workflows. Major items include migration of package retrieval to the Package2Version API with refined error handling and metadata messaging; introduction of a new permission (DownloadPackageVersionZips) and corresponding permission set to enable packaging operations; and targeted resilience improvements for scenarios where DeveloperUsePkgZip is unavailable or packaging is not enabled. A rollback was performed to revert the addition of the perm set after a test-suite change, and duplicate-permission-set assignment edge-cases were addressed to improve stability.
June 2025 monthly summary for forcedotcom/packaging. Focus on delivering reliable packaging capabilities and enabling packaging operations in the Dev Hub. The month delivered key features and fixes that improve reliability, error clarity, and security- and test-robustness across packaging workflows. Major items include migration of package retrieval to the Package2Version API with refined error handling and metadata messaging; introduction of a new permission (DownloadPackageVersionZips) and corresponding permission set to enable packaging operations; and targeted resilience improvements for scenarios where DeveloperUsePkgZip is unavailable or packaging is not enabled. A rollback was performed to revert the addition of the perm set after a test-suite change, and duplicate-permission-set assignment edge-cases were addressed to improve stability.
Overview of all repositories you've contributed to across your timeline